Ugwu Karthala
Mount Karthala or Karthola (Arabic: القرطالة Al Qirṭālah)bụ ugwu mgbawa na-arụ ọrụ na ebe kachasị elu nke Comoros dị mita 2,361 (ụkwụ 7,746) n'elu oke osimiri. Ọ bụ nke kachasị na ndịda na nke kacha ibu n'ime ugwu mgbawa abụọ ahụ na-eme agwaetiti Grande Comore, agwaetiti kachasị na mba Comoros. Ugwu mgbawa Karthala na-arụsi ọrụ ike nke ukwuu, ebe ọ gbawara ihe karịrị ugboro 20 kemgbe narị afọ nke 19. Mgbawa ugboro ugboro emeela ka ugwu mgbawa ahụ dị kilomita 3 site na ugwu caldera 4 kilomita, mana agwaetiti ahụ agbaala nnukwu mbibi. Mgbawa mgbawa na Eprel 17, 2005 na Mee 29, 2006 kwụsịrị oge udo..

Mgbawa nke Eprel 2005
[dezie | dezie ebe o si]
Mgbawa ahụ, nke bu ihe ize ndụ nke mgbawa ugwu na gas na-egbu egbu, mere ka ndị bi na ya 2,000 pụọ, nke dugara n'ọnwụ nwa ọhụrụ.[1] Mgbawa ahụ gbanwere nke ọma na olulu mmiri ahụ. Ala ntụ ntụ gbara olulu mmiri ahụ gburugburu, caldera ahụ dịkwa ka ọ buru ibu ma dị omimi. Ọdọ mmiri ahụ, nke malitere mgbe Karthala gbawara agbawa ikpeazụ na 1991 ma bụrụkwa nke chịrị caldera, apụọla kpamkpam. N'ọnọdụ ya, e nwere nkume isi awọ gbara ọchịchịrị, nke nwere ike ịdị jụụ ma ọ bụ ihe mkpofu sitere na olulu mmiri ahụ dara ada.
Ọrụ May 2006
[dezie | dezie ebe o si]Na Mee 29, Reuters kọrọ na ndị bi na Moroni nwere ike ịhụ lava na-agbapụta n'elu ugwu ahụ.[2] N'ime ụbọchị ole na ole, ọrụ mgbawa ugwu ahụ belatara.
Flora na anụmanụ
[dezie | dezie ebe o si]Ugwu ahụ jupụtara n'oké ọhịa na-acha akwụkwọ ndụ akwụkwọ ndụ site na mita 1200 ruo ihe dị ka mita 1800 n'elu oke osimiri. N'elu, ahịhịa na-agụnye osisi ndị na-adịghị mma na ala ahịhịhịa ebe nnukwu heather Erica comorensis na-eto.[3] Oké ọhịa ugwu ahụ nọ n'ihe ize ndụ site na igbu osisi na mgbasa nke ọrụ ugbo. Ọtụtụ n'ime ụdị ndị a hụrụ n'ugwu ahụ bụ ndị pụrụ iche na Comoros na ụdị nnụnụ anọ a na-ahụ naanị na ndagwurugwu nke Ugwu Karthala: Grand Comoro drongo, Humblot's flycatcher, Karthala scops owl, na Karthala white-eye.
Ebe Nnụnụ Dị Mkpa
[dezie | dezie ebe o si]A 14,228 ha (35,160-acre) tract encompassing the upper slopes and summit of the mountain has been designated an Important Bird Area (IBA) by BirdLife International, because it supports populations of Comoros blue pigeons, Comoros fodies, Comoros olive pigeons, Comoros thrushes, Grand Comoro brush warblers, Grand Comoro bulbuls, Grand Comoro drongos, Humblot's flycatchers, Humblot's sunbirds, Karthala scops owls, Karthala white-eyes, na Malagasy harriers.[4]
Ogige Ntụrụndụ Karthala
[dezie | dezie ebe o si]Ogige Ntụrụndụ Karthala na-echebe mpaghara nke 2.14 km2 n'ugwu ahụ. A họpụtara ya na 2010.[5]
